**About the Role**

As a Quality Officer, you will be responsible for conducting receiving and first article inspections of mechanical and electronic parts. Working closely with our engineering and production teams, you’ll ensure all inspected parts meet the required specifications, supporting our quality assurance efforts across multiple sites.

**Key Responsibilities**
- Perform inspections of electronic and mechanical parts in accordance with inspection test plans (ITPs) and technical drawings.
- Record inspection results and maintain accurate supplier documentation.
- Create and use process checklists to support inter-site quality inspections.
- Review and suggest improvements to manufacturing process instructions and testing documentation.
- Operate precision instruments (verniers, micrometres, microscopes) to verify conformity.
- Draft non-conformance reports and support corrective action reviews.
- Assist with defect management in line with company procedures.
- Provide general support to the Quality team as required.
